Amazon Expands Online Grocery Shopping in the UK

It's one thing to shake up an old-fashioned industry like the bookselling industry, but it's quite another to rival Tesco in the grocery sector. The move could harm the margins of supermarkets which are already sluggish.

But is it working? The e-commerce giant is trying to catch up in the UK's highly competitive food industry however its share of online shopping has barely cracked 3percent, according to Mintel.

With a market share of less than a tenth of Tesco's, Amazon has fired a new volley in the fight for Britain's wallets. It plans to expand the online Fresh service to include all major cities and towns in the UK, starting with London and selected Home Counties. This puts it in a small concurrence with Deliveroo who already offer same-hour grocery delivery in London. Amazon will also compete with its own third-party marketplace partner, like Waitrose and Morrisons.

This latest move is unlikely to have a significant impact on the overall sales of supermarkets however it could cause a stir among some big players. In fact, retail workers are represented by the union Usdaw has expressed concerns that the new venture could result in job losses.

Prime members will get free same-day delivery within London and maps.google.com.om selected Home Counties. Customers will also have access to the option of 10,000 chilled and frozen products that are supplied by a variety of independent and brand suppliers. This includes artisanal producers like Gail's Artisan Bakery, C Lidgate and Booths, Whole Foods Market and Danone, Britvic and Arla.

Although the launch of this new service is bound to draw attention but its impact on UK grocery sales will be minimal. Mintel's most recent online grocery report shows that more than half of online shoppers in the UK purchase their groceries from supermarket websites. The largest are Ocado & Tesco. The big four supermarkets are unlikely to engage in pricing wars with Amazon's size. They will continue to depend on their huge store portfolios, Click-and-Collect services, and national delivery options.

It is possible that Amazon will decide that the best approach to enter the eGrocery sector is to work with existing supermarket chains. It already has a number of these agreements in place, such as a deal with the upmarket retailer Waitrose that allows the company to sell its products on the Amazon website and then deliver the products to customers. It also has a deal with discount retailer Iceland that allows its own website to sell products via Amazon which is delivered from local stores.

Amazon recently announced that in an effort to expand its market share in the UK it will match the prices of a limited number grocery items on its website with the best deals available to Tesco Clubcard card holders. The move was designed to compete against discounters who have been taking away market share from the four major supermarkets. It will also allow Amazon to better target a market that is increasingly price-conscious and has less disposable income.

Despite its huge ambitions in the retail sector, Amazon has struggled to make inroads. A new shot this week was fired in its battle with the UK's powerful incumbents which could allow the company to move from being a bit-part player to becoming one of the country's most serious challengers.

Amazon's latest move is a partnership between Iceland and Prime members that allows customers to purchase their entire grocery purchases from the store and have it delivered free. The service is available in London but will be extended to other cities by the end of 2021. The company also has launched a one-hour delivery service for groceries in London, which will be expanded to millions of Prime members nationwide.

Retail experts have stated that Amazon's entry into grocery sector will not be easy. If it is to become a serious competitor, it must to remove the obstacles to entry. One such barrier is being removed slowly by the requirement to sign up for prime. In the same way, the requirement that customers pay for Amazon Fresh as an additional service to Prime is now replaced by the option to simply pay per delivery.

The size of the British supermarket market is an additional problem. It is highly competitive. Amazon will be unable to compete with the big supermarkets such as Tesco and Sainsbury's without lowering prices. It is possible to achieve this using its scale and matching Tesco's Clubcard Prices across hundreds of grocery items.
